|
Improved Accuracy and Reliability: Selenium Automated testing services execute precisely and consistently, minimizing human errors that may occur during manual testing. This consistency enhances the reliability of test results and reduces false positives and negatives.
Early Detection of Bugs: Automated tests can be integrated into the development process, allowing for early detection of bugs and issues. This enables faster bug fixing and prevents the accumulation of technical debt over time. Regression Testing: Selenium excels at regression testing, which involves retesting specific areas of the application after code changes. Automated regression tests help ensure that new updates do not negatively impact existing functionalities. Continuous Integration and Continuous Delivery (CI/CD) Support: Selenium can be seamlessly integrated into CI/CD pipelines, enabling automatic testing of new code changes during the development process. This facilitates the delivery of high-quality software at a faster pace. |
|
Selenium is a popular open-source framework used for automated testing of web applications. It offers numerous benefits that make it a preferred choice for software testing. Here are some of the key benefits of using Selenium for automated testing:
1. **Cross-Browser and Platform Compatibility:** Selenium supports various web browsers, including Chrome, Firefox, Safari, Internet Explorer, and Edge. It allows testers to execute tests across different browsers and platforms, ensuring consistent functionality and user experience for all users. 2. **Open-Source and Cost-Effective:** Selenium is an open-source tool, which means it is freely available and has a large community of developers contributing to its improvement. This makes it a cost-effective option for organizations compared to commercial testing tools. 3. **Support for Multiple Programming Languages:** Selenium supports multiple programming languages, such as Java, C#, Python, Ruby, and JavaScript. Testers can choose their preferred language for scripting automated tests, making it accessible to developers with diverse skill sets. 4. **Integration with Test Frameworks:** Selenium can be integrated with popular testing frameworks like TestNG and JUnit, allowing testers to manage test cases, create test suites, and generate test reports efficiently. 5. **Wide Range of Testing Scenarios:** Selenium supports various testing scenarios, including functional testing, regression testing, performance testing, and load testing. It can interact with elements on a web page just like a real user, enabling comprehensive test coverage. 6. **Parallel Test Execution:** Selenium Grid allows testers to execute test scripts in parallel on multiple browsers and devices simultaneously. This significantly reduces the time required to execute a large number of test cases, improving test efficiency. 7. **Easy Maintenance and Reusability:** Selenium promotes modular test design, allowing testers to create reusable components and libraries. This reduces redundancy, simplifies maintenance, and ensures consistency in test cases. 8. **Support for Headless Testing:** Selenium can execute tests in headless mode, meaning it can run tests without opening a graphical user interface. Headless testing is faster and can be useful for running tests in continuous integration and continuous deployment (CI/CD) pipelines. 9. **Integration with CI/CD Pipelines:** Selenium seamlessly integrates with popular CI/CD tools like Jenkins, allowing automated tests to be triggered automatically on code changes, providing faster feedback to developers. 10. **Robust Community Support:** Selenium has a large and active community of users and contributors. This means there are extensive online resources, forums, and documentation available to help testers and developers troubleshoot issues and find solutions. In conclusion, Selenium's flexibility, cross-browser compatibility, open-source nature, and strong community support make it a powerful and efficient tool for automating web application testing, ultimately leading to improved software quality and faster delivery of reliable web applications. |
|
In reply to this post by katherin15
Best 4 Ways To Buy ritalin-methylphenidate 10mg,15mg, 20mg Over the Counter (Goodrx ritalin-methylphenidate ) Online
best place to buy ritalin-methylphenidate online ritalin ( methylphenidate ) is a potent central nervous system (CNS) stimulant for the treatment of regolate hyperactivityADHD) in childiren and adults, and narcolepsy (loss of the brain's ability to regulate sleep-wake cycles normally). ritalin has potential for abuse and should only be used as prescribed. <tps:https://www.flymedishop.com /https://www.flymedishop.com/product/buy-ritalin-methylphenidate-10mg-online/ "> ritalin With Or Without Prescription Buy valium Online Buy adderall online <a href="https://www.flymedishop.com /" rel="dofollow">Buy diazepam (valium ) over the counter goodrx ecstacy goodrx ketamine 20 mg desoxyn over the counter goodrx captagon 15 mg goodrx caffeine 30 mg adderall for depression <a href="https://www.flymedishop.com/product/unwind-mushroom-for-sale/ /">dexedrine vs adderall fentanyl Legit plug, pils, ecstasy, Xanax,coke ,cbd oil and top strains of medical marijuana for more inquiries Of CONTACT US Email : info@flymedishop.com Phone : +1(951) 663-4209 Both Adderall and Vyvanse are central nervous system stimulants. ...The difference between the drugs is Adderall contains amphetamine salts (amphetamine and iS dextroamphetamine), whereas Vyvanse contains lisdexamfetamine, which the body converts to dextroamphetamine before it is active, meaning it's a "prodrug " <a href="https://www.flymedishop.com/product/buy-carisoprodol-online/ "> carisoprodol (carisoprodol ) Carisoprodol is used short-term to treat muscle pain and discomfort |
| Free forum by Nabble | Edit this page |
